With World of Frozen officially opening on March 29, 2026, in Disney Adventure World (Walt Disney Studios Park), Disneyland Paris has shared more details about what guests can expect when visiting this highly anticipated new themed land.
Just like during the opening of Avengers Campus, Disney will closely monitor capacity during the first weeks/months. Due to the high demand expected, access to World of Frozen may be temporarily regulated to ensure a comfortable experience for all guests. Disneyland Paris shared this information about entering the land with a few tips:
GENERAL INFORMATION
No reservation is required to enter World of Frozen, as long as guests have a valid admission ticket for Disney Adventure World and a registration for the day of their visit. Due to the high level of demand expected, guests may be asked to wait in a dedicated access queue before entering the land.
GUESTS WITH A RESERVATION
A dedicated access line will be available for Guests who have booked A Royal Encounter with Elsa and Anna inside Arendelle Castle. Please plan ahead if you have a reservation. We recommend arriving at least 20 minutes before your time slot, but please note that the waiting time to access World of Frozen may be longer.
The Frozen Ever After attraction will have a dedicated Disney Premier Access line. However, Disney Premier Access Ultimate does not grant access to the dedicated access line for World of Frozen.
All Disney Premier Access products are available in limited quantities and are subject to availability.
Please note that upon the opening of Frozen Ever After, the Disney Premier Access queue may be unavailable without prior notice for operational reasons, or Disney Premier Access One may not be on sale.
GUESTS WITH DISABILITIES
For guests with disabilities, a priority access queue will be available for those holding a Priority Card or an Easy Access Card, depending on individual needs. No reservation is required to enter World of Frozen itself using this priority access.

When World of Frozen opens on March 29, 2026, guests will step into Arendelle during the Snowflower Festival, a joyful celebration inspired by the Frozen films. While the land is similar to the World of Frozen that opened at Hong Kong Disneyland in 2023, the Paris version will not include Wandering Oaken’s Sliding Sleighs and Playhouse in the Woods.

The opening of World of Frozen also marks a major milestone for the park. Adventure Way and Adventure Bay will open at the same time, introducing the new family attraction Raiponce Tangled Spin and the brand-new Regal View Restaurant & Lounge. Once night falls, Adventure Bay will come alive with the debut of Disney Cascade of Lights, a groundbreaking new nighttime spectacular.
With these additions, Walt Disney Studios Park will officially become Disney Adventure World, marking the start of a new era for this park. And this is only the beginning, as a Lion King-themed land is already under construction.
